William S. “Taz” Reeher, Sr., age 73, of College Hill area of Beaver Falls, PA passed away peacefully on November 20, 2024 at the Heritage Valley Medical Center in Beaver.
He was born on February 16, 1951 in Beaver Falls, the son of the late William C. and Sylvia Plake Reeher.
He grew up in the little town of Koppel, PA where he played baseball for his home team. William attended the old St. Teresa Catholic School and Church where he was an Altar boy for many years. He was a graduate of Lincoln High School, Ellwood City - Class of 1969.
William is survived by his son William S. Reeher, Jr. of Big Beaver; two brothers Donald (Karen) of Big Beaver, John of Beaver Falls, and a sister Joyce (Mark) Medlin of Beaver Falls; cousins, many nieces and nephews and a special friend Judith Horner. Also, his fur baby “Kitty”.
William currently was working as a night watchman at McDanel Advanced Ceramic Technologies in Beaver Falls. He formerly worked at B.F. Carnegie Library and Veka Inc. in Fombell.
He loved nature and had a big heart always helping others.
Per his wishes no services will be held.
Arrangements entrusted to the Marshall Funeral Home.
